I graduated in Mechanical Engineering from the Polytechnical University of Timi¿oara, Romania, in 1993. On July 16, 2004, I received my PhD in Mechanical Engineering from the Faculty of Engineering at the University of Porto, Portugal. From 1999 to 2007, I held a five-year Ph.D. scholarship and a three-year postdoctoral scholarship, both of which were granted by FCT. Since 2007, I have been a researcher at the Center for Mechanical Technology and Automation and, since 2021, at LASI (the Intelligent Systems Associate Laboratory). I am also a member of the Scientific Committee of the European Scientific Association for Material Forming (ESAFORM). My work has focused on developing models to predict sheet metal forming limits under linear and complex loadings using advanced phenomenological and physically based plasticity models. I developed several original software packages for predicting Forming Limit Diagrams. The quality and breadth of these results have allowed me to develop extensive expertise in material modelling and the development of scientific software.
